Hypnotherapy guides you into a natural trance-like state, a condition most people experience daily. For example, when you drive to work every day, you may find yourself navigating the route automatically, without consciously thinking about every turn. In this state, you’re fully aware of your surroundings, but your subconscious mind takes over.

A 2003 study titled “Hypnosis and Clinical Pain” by Patterson, D.R., & Jensen, M. in the Psychological Bulletin demonstrated hypnosis’s effectiveness in managing both acute and chronic pain.

The study shows that hypnosis reduces pain across chronic conditions and outperforms many non-hypnotic interventions.

Hypnotherapists focus on working with your subconscious mind to address underlying thoughts and behaviors.
